Output ec82f7e5426f6ce7271db6f179176850d52cd500943b4b10e75aad2f5d5ef73e:2

value
609664
script pubkey
OP_0 OP_PUSHBYTES_20 aa4fe24ab3965c9bf1c83f8bcd0c904978a9c3e8
address
bc1q4f87yj4njewfhuwg879u6rysf9u2nslga27t4s
transaction
ec82f7e5426f6ce7271db6f179176850d52cd500943b4b10e75aad2f5d5ef73e
spent
true